Title :
Functional and structural properties in the Model-Driven Engineering approach
Author :
Cancila, Daniela ; Passerone, Roberto
Author_Institution :
DIMI, Univ. degli Studi di Udine, Udine
Abstract :
In this paper we discuss the separation between attributes on functionality and on structure following an approach based on model driven engineering (MDE). We adopt a methodological approach based on correctness-by-construction for modeling high-integrity real-time embedded systems. We illustrate how this separation is implemented by a prototype, recently realized by our research team. Software reuse is incremented by using the prototype. This has been confirmed by the evaluation of two teams from major European space industry. We conclude our work by discussing some open problems.
Keywords :
embedded systems; software reusability; correctness-by-construction; model-driven engineering; real-time embedded systems; software reuse; Aerospace industry; Application software; Computer architecture; Connectors; Model driven engineering; Prototypes; Quality of service; Real time systems; Security; Software prototyping;
Conference_Titel :
Emerging Technologies and Factory Automation, 2008. ETFA 2008. IEEE International Conference on
Conference_Location :
Hamburg
Print_ISBN :
978-1-4244-1505-2
Electronic_ISBN :
978-1-4244-1506-9
DOI :
10.1109/ETFA.2008.4638491